(02-16-2026, 08:08 PM)b789 Wrote: Definitely take a costs schedule and don’t forget to ask for your cost if/when successful. Burgess never attends these. The only reason this one progressed to this stage is because it is for more than 2 PCNS.

They will almost certainly send an advocate. The advocate will know nothing about the case. You should try and understand the meaning of VCS v Leyland. An advocate who says they are a “solicitors agent” does not have a right to audience although the judge can use their discretion. If you can show the persuasive argument in Leyland, the judge may also send them packing.

Remember, you are on a very strong dotting here. No contract, no driver identity. The burden of proof is on the claimant. You just say prove who was the driver and prove that an actual contract was formed.

Just wanted to post an update to say that I attended the hearing today and won! Hugely grateful for all the support you have provided to me. The two main points that it seemed to hinge on, unsurprisingly, were them not being able to prove the identity of the driver and the contract issue.

Thank you for all the guidance, without which I probably wouldn't have taken it this far. Burgess of course did not attend but an agent did. The judge said he could not find VCS v Edward online but fortunately I had printed off copies of it. The judge was very helpful. The judge awarded me £103 costs.

For anyone else reading this in a similar situation, the judge agreed that I was under no legal obligation to disclose who the driver was to VCS. He said that there may be a gap in the law but it was not for this court to act on that.
